Skin rejuvenation treatments, such as laser resurfacing, microneedling, and chemical peels, work by stimulating collagen production and addressing issues like wrinkles, pigmentation, and sun damage. These non-invasive procedures result in smoother, firmer skin, enhancing texture and tone while reducing signs of aging.
Dermatological surgery includes procedures like mole removal, skin cancer excision, and scar revision. It is recommended for treating abnormal skin growths, improving skin appearance, or addressing health concerns. These surgeries are precise, safe, and designed to restore skin health, often with minimal scarring.
Laser treatments target various skin issues like acne scars, wrinkles, and sunspots by using focused light to stimulate skin renewal. Popular options include fractional CO2 and IPL. These treatments are non-invasive, require little downtime, and provide lasting improvements in skin texture, tone, and overall appearance.
Botox applications temporarily relax facial muscles to re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Common areas treated include the forehead, crow’s feet, and frown lines. The procedure is quick, minimally invasive, and provides a smooth, youthful appearance with no downtime. Results typically last for 3-6 months.
Non-surgical aesthetics offer a wide range of treatments such as Botox, dermal fillers, and chemical peels that improve appearance without the need for invasive surgery. These procedures are safe, require minimal downtime, and deliver natural-looking, youthful results. Non-surgical aesthetics are ideal for those seeking quick enhancements with long-lasting effects.
